Join us at the Tulsa Fire Museum as we proudly celebrate Hispanic Heritage Month with a special program honoring Miriam Bryant, Tulsa’s first Hispanic female firefighter.
Miriam’s groundbreaking career not only opened doors for women and Hispanic professionals in the fire service, but also set a powerful example of perseverance, courage, and dedication to community. Her story reflects the strength and diversity that have shaped Tulsa’s firefighting history and continue to inspire the next generation.
This year’s program will feature a bilingual interview conducted by Professor Tina Peña of Tulsa Community College, who will guide the conversation in both Spanish and English. Together, they will explore Miriam’s journey—from her early inspirations to the challenges she overcame, her proudest accomplishments, and the legacy she hopes to leave for future firefighters.
